The Karnataka 2nd PUC Accountancy exam concluded today, March 14, 2026 . The examination took place from 10:15 AM to 1:30 PM. The Karnataka School Examination and Assessment Board (KSEAB) conducted the exam for the 2025-26 academic year.
Exam Structure and Marking
The Accountancy paper follows an 80+20 marking scheme. The theory paper is worth 80 marks. Students also receive 20 marks for internal assessments. These internal marks are based on unit tests, projects, and assignments.
Passing Criteria
To pass the Karnataka 2nd PUC Accountancy examination, students need a minimum score. They must achieve 24 marks out of 80 in the theory section. Additionally, students require 6 or 7 marks out of 20 for their internal assessment.
